dc.description.abstract | ICT projects integration in education is the adoption of modern computer related equipment into the classroom to make material preparation, teaching and learning process easy. The primary reason of the research was to discover the factors that influence integration of information communication technology projects in our public primary schools, Mombasa sub-District, Mombasa County. The study was guided by four objectives that sought to find out what really influence the price of ICT training facilities on the integration of ICT projects in public primary schools in Mombasa County, and access the influence of ICT infrastructural capacity for learning in the integration of ICT projects in public primary schools in Mombasa central sub-County. The objectives also formed the themes in literature review under various sub headings. An illustrative approach was embraced for the study since the research was more of a social research than an experimental research. In the study stratified random sampling was used in accordance to the characteristics the constituents in the population processed. The research targeted teachers, school heads involved in the day to day ICT use in schools and their deputy heads. The target population was 96 but a population sample of 76 was used. A pilot structured questionnaire which was administered personally via e-mails, enumerators and pick them after they have been filled. Data was coded and analyzed using SPSS. The data was analyzed and the relationships together with the finding in chapter four discussed in chapter five. Conclusion, recommendation and suggestions for future studies were given. | en_US |
